Residential glass replacement services involve removing damaged or outdated glass from windows, doors, or other glass fixtures and installing new panels to restore appearance and functionality. This process typically includes carefully removing the broken or worn glass, preparing the frame for the new piece, and securely fitting the replacement to ensure a proper seal. Skilled service providers often handle various types of glass, including clear, frosted, or decorative options, to match the existing style of the property. This service helps homeowners maintain the aesthetic appeal of their homes while ensuring safety and energy efficiency.
Glass replacement becomes necessary when existing glass becomes cracked, shattered, foggy, or otherwise compromised. Common problems include accidental impacts that cause breakage, thermal stress leading to cracks, or age-related deterioration that results in cloudy or hazy panes. Replacing damaged glass can improve the overall look of a home, prevent drafts, and enhance security by eliminating weak points. Additionally, replacing outdated or single-pane windows with modern, energy-efficient options can contribute to lower utility bills and a more comfortable living environment.

The overview below groups typical Residential Glass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Granbury, TX.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for small residential glass replacements, such as a single window or a small pane, generally range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on glass type and accessibility. Fewer projects tend to push into the higher end of this spectrum.
Mid-Size Projects - Replacing multiple windows or larger panes usually costs between $600 and $1,500. Local contractors often handle these projects regularly within this range, with prices varying based on glass quality and installation complexity. Larger or more customized jobs can reach higher prices.
Full Window Replacement - Complete replacement of an entire window unit typically costs from $1,500 to $3,500. Many homeowners in Granbury, TX, find their projects fall into this range, though larger or premium window styles can push costs upward.
Larger or Custom Projects - Extensive glass replacements, such as multiple custom-sized or specialty glass installations, can exceed $5,000. Such projects are less common and usually involve more complex work, materials, or design features that increase the overall cost.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
